Some days I wish it was socially acceptable to

run into the garden

and scream into the sky.

I wish to tear every shred of weight out of my chest

and I wish to tear my vocal cords into shreds until silence.

Some days I want to howl into the sky for no reason in particular

And those days I almost wish I’ll scream louder than those people building bridges.

I swear I’m not getting murdered.

There’s too much breath in my lungs, that’s all.
